Doxypal DR-L Capsule

Prescription Icon
Prescription Required

Marketer

Jagsonpal Pharmaceuticals Ltd

Salt Composition

Doxycycline (100mg) + Lactobacillus (5Billion Spores)

Overview Doxypal DR-L Capsule

Combiflox DR-L Capsules combat various bacterial infections by inhibiting microbial proliferation. This medication also helps mitigate treatment-associated diarrhea. Always follow your physician's instructions; Combiflox DR-L is a prescription drug. Dosage timing is crucial for optimal results, and can be taken with or without food. Exceeding the prescribed dose can be harmful. If you miss a dose, take it promptly. Complete the full course of treatment, even with symptom improvement; premature cessation may reduce its effectiveness. Common side effects may include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and indigestion. Report worsening side effects to your doctor immediately. Seek immediate medical attention for allergic reactions (rash, itching, swelling, breathing difficulty). Inform your doctor about all other medications you're taking, especially if pregnant or breastfeeding. Alcohol should be avoided due to potential increased drowsiness. While generally non-impairing, avoid driving if drowsiness or dizziness occurs. Adequate rest, a balanced diet, and sufficient hydration will aid recovery.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Avoid alcohol while taking Doxypal DR-L Capsules.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Using Doxypal DR-L Capsules during pregnancy poses a confirmed risk to the fetus and is therefore inadvisable. Nevertheless, in exceptionally dangerous circumstances, a physician might consider its use if the potential advantages outweigh the hazards. Always se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Using Doxypal DR-L Capsules while breastfeeding is likely safe. Available human data indicates minimal ris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Doxycycline, as contained in Doxypal DR-L Capsules, can cause drowsiness, visual impairment, and d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ced. Blurred vision is a possible side effect of doxycycline therapy.

KidneyKidney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on Doxypal DR-L Capsule use in individuals with kidney impairment is scarce.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should exercise caution when using Doxypal DR-L Capsules; dosage modification may be necessary. A physician's cons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Doxypal DR-L Capsule :

Should you forget a Doxypal DR-L Capsule dose, take it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
